Output 8660ce223b1c26dbb07e8d6cadd6c55a8a1a1c77749b60dabc848f74fe3927e7:13

value
495900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cc7a73538aa5da0b4cea052344fe0756d01ee6 OP_EQUAL
address
3FiEGJAPHzNaeYATXEbTFNhViJEu4bGn2t
transaction
8660ce223b1c26dbb07e8d6cadd6c55a8a1a1c77749b60dabc848f74fe3927e7
spent
true